Output cc3fb63bcdf5621dee60b75f82d2089c6c847ccf8675106d34b86f30dbd15d02:1

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c4417d56e43b2eb1c7f608cd4157b67e71ca29b9 OP_EQUALVERIFY OP_CHECKSIG
address
1JthttzcUjDHA85m1ywxCbxwmLjdCuemDA
transaction
cc3fb63bcdf5621dee60b75f82d2089c6c847ccf8675106d34b86f30dbd15d02
confirmations
428013
spent
true